GHSA-v7v8-gjv7-ffmr: @excalidraw/excalidraw Cross-site Scripting vulnerability

### Impact XSS vulnerability due to improperly sanitizing URLs of links that can be attached on canvas elements. This affects users of the npm package `@excalidraw/excalidraw` provided it was deployed in environments where untrusted user input in drawings that are then shared with third parties is a concern. If you only hosted the editor in trusted environments, or sharing didn't take place, the impact is minimized. ### Patches Patch is available on version 0.15.3 and up (stable), or latest `@excalidraw/excalidraw@next` (unstable releases). ### Workarounds No workaround without upgrading unless deployed in environments without untrusted user input. ### References https://security.snyk.io/vuln/SNYK-JS-EXCALIDRAWEXCALIDRAW-5841658 https://github.com/excalidraw/excalidraw/pull/6728

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-6290-1

Ubuntu Security Notice 6290-1 - It was discovered that LibTIFF could be made to write out of bounds when processing certain malformed image files with the tiffcrop utility. If a user were tricked into opening a specially crafted image file, an attacker could possibly use this issue to cause tiffcrop to crash, resulting in a denial of service, or possibly execute arbitrary code. This issue only affected Ubuntu 18.04 LTS, Ubuntu 20.04 LTS, and Ubuntu 22.04 LTS. It was discovered that LibTIFF incorrectly handled certain image files. If a user were tricked into opening a specially crafted image file, an attacker could possibly use this issue to cause a denial of service. This issue only affected Ubuntu 23.04.

GHSA-36fg-whr2-g999: Jenkins NodeJS Plugin improper credential masking vulnerability

Jenkins NodeJS Plugin integrates with Config File Provider Plugin to specify custom NPM settings, including credentials for authentication, in a Npm config file. NodeJS Plugin 1.6.0 and earlier does not properly mask (i.e., replace with asterisks) credentials specified in the Npm config file in Pipeline build logs. NodeJS Plugin 1.6.0.1 masks credentials specified in the Npm config file in Pipeline build logs.

CVE-2023-40338: Jenkins Security Advisory 2023-08-16

Jenkins Folders Plugin 6.846.v23698686f0f6 and earlier displays an error message that includes an absolute path of a log file when attempting to access the Scan Organization Folder Log if no logs are available, exposing information about the Jenkins controller file system.

CVE-2023-40345: Jenkins Security Advisory 2023-08-16

Jenkins Delphix Plugin 3.0.2 and earlier does not set the appropriate context for credentials lookup, allowing attackers with Overall/Read permission to access and capture credentials they are not entitled to.

CVE-2023-40350: Jenkins Security Advisory 2023-08-16

Jenkins Docker Swarm Plugin 1.11 and earlier does not escape values returned from Docker before inserting them into the Docker Swarm Dashboard view, resulting in a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ability exploitable by attackers able to control responses from Docker.
